Make sure that your kids do their share of chores, and you can even hire help if needed. Doing all of the work yourself can be hard. Your everyday household and motherly duties, homeschooling, and everything else you need to do will be overwhelming unless you call in help. Accept help if you get it and don't feel bad about it.

Find a group of families that also does homeschooling. There are more homeschooling families than you might think. You will be amazed at the number of families in your area that homeschool their kids. Use blogs and forums to help you find other families. You can discuss problems, gain ideas and trade curriculum materials with them. It is also a good opportunity for your children to make friends. Being a part of a homeschooling group will give you many benefits.

Have your kids write in a journal on a daily basis. This journal gives you a written record of your child's educational progress and their lives as a whole. It allows them to express themselves and can give you an insight to how they are feeling. Let them dress up the journal with personal artwork and creativity. This will be something that they can keep for many years, and it can also be part of their future portfolio.
